Nuclear Energy

Nuclear energy is the energy released during nuclear reactions, particularly through the processes of nuclear fission or nuclear fusion. In nuclear fission, the nucleus of an atom splits into smaller parts, releasing a significant amount of energy. This process is commonly used in nuclear power plants to generate electricity. Conversely, nuclear fusion involves combining lighter atomic nuclei to form a heavier nucleus, which also releases energy. Fusion is the process that powers stars, including the sun.

Nuclear energy can be harnessed for various applications, including electricity generation, medical treatments, and research. It is considered a low-carbon energy source, as it produces minimal greenhouse gas emissions during operation compared to fossil fuels. However, it raises concerns regarding radioactive waste management, nuclear accidents, and the potential for weapon proliferation.

Overall, nuclear energy is a powerful and highly concentrated source of energy derived from nuclear reactions, with the capacity to address energy needs in a variety of contexts while also presenting environmental and safety challenges.
